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
277 4867 99007615452 09464157631
15946751262 58657971366
15946751262 58657971366
954 42709118271 46236954822
All about undefined
Interested in learning more?
15946751262 58657971366
954 42709118271 46236954822
See more
862878802 73779 812
613 72888579 91817199947
See more
1034265735 8519 75311
2082612 5996 892
See more